KathyN22

KathyN22asked

I've had mine for a while and usually just drag fibres etc off the roller. I did manage once to get the clear visor off but now I can't . Am I supposed to push the silver buttons down to release it? They don't depress at all when I try that. Must be something simple I'm not doing, any help appreciated. The instruction guide is no help at all.



1 answer
Chris
Chris

Hi Kathy ... long time reply and maybe you have consigned your sweeper to the bin by now? But it's easy to remove the clear plastic roller cover - in fact it releases from the opposite point to those silver buttons which are just "anchor points". Look down and around each side of the cover to lower corners - you can lift cover out and off the little pegs around there! You will find it can now be lifted off those buttons and you can easily wash the plastic and give the roller a good spring clean!! :)
